Understanding Capsaicin: The Active Ingredient
Capsaicin, the active ingredient in pepper spray, is a natural compound derived from chili peppers. It’s what gives spices their heat and pungent flavor. In crowd control applications, capsaicin creates a temporary but intense irritant effect on the eyes, nose, and respiratory system. This reaction leads to symptoms like tearing, coughing, difficulty breathing, and pain, effectively deterring aggressive or violent behavior.
Beyond its immediate effects, capsaicin has been studied for its potential in various medical treatments due to its anti-inflammatory and analgesic properties. How Pepper Spray Affects the Body and Mind
Pepper spray, a compound derived from chili peppers, primarily affects the body and mind through its interaction with nerve endings. When sprayed onto the skin or eyes, capsaicin, the active ingredient, binds to receptor sites on nerve cells, triggering a response that leads to pain, irritation, and temporary numbness. This direct impact on the nervous system causes the characteristic burning sensation and can result in temporary blindness if sprayed into the eyes.
Beyond physical symptoms, pepper spray also has psychological effects. The intense stimulus can induce fear, panic, and disorientation, making it an effective crowd-control tool. Efficacy and Safety: A Balancing Act in Crowd Control
Capsaicin-based inflammatory crowd control sprays have established themselves as potent tools in managing large gatherings and maintaining public safety. The active ingredient, capsaicin, triggers a burning sensation when it comes into contact with skin or eyes, effectively deterring aggressive behaviors and dispersing crowds. This mechanism makes such sprays highly effective in de-escalating tense situations, from riot control to crowd management at events.
However, balancing efficacy and safety is paramount. While capsaicin spray can quickly disrupt a crowd, it must be used responsibly to avoid causing excessive harm or long-term health issues.
